I'd like to give the eschatologue 120 cargo capacity, to match the merchant cruiser. Since it's an absurdly expensive endgame reward, i'd rather it be a straight upgrade. Plus i love trading, and i really can't stand looking at the caligo any more, the three non-aligned crates on it upset me.

is it possible to do this by editing the game files? Can anyone provide info on how?

Just open qualities.json and search
"Id":4814},{"Level":100
or just 4814 and then change the 100 of that very next "Level": to 120.


Note that a) you'll need to do this again for each new chaptain and b)if you're at zee with that ship, it'll take a few seconds for the change to take effect the first time.
